Saltar a contenido

Sesiones

Las sesiones son conversaciones individuales con agentes que mantienen su propio contexto e historial.

¿Qué es una sesión?

Una sesión es:

  • Una conversación con un agente específico
  • Un contexto que se mantiene durante la interacción
  • Un historial de mensajes y acciones
  • Un espacio de trabajo para un tema específico

Panel de sesiones

┌─────────────────────┐
│ Sesiones            │
├─────────────────────┤
│                     │
│ ▶ Revisión docs     │
│   📝 documentation  │
│   hace 5 min        │
│   ─────────────     │
│                     │
│   Deploy staging    │
│   🔧 devops-troubl  │
│   hace 2 horas      │
│   ─────────────     │
│                     │
│   Optimizar BD      │
│   💾 database-opt   │
│   ayer              │
│                     │
├─────────────────────┤
│ [+ Nueva sesión]    │
└─────────────────────┘

Elementos de una sesión

Elemento Descripción
Indicador ▶ Sesión activa
Nombre Título descriptivo
Agente Icono y nombre del agente
Tiempo Última actividad

Crear nueva sesión

Paso 1: Clic en "+ Nueva sesión"

Se abre el diálogo de creación:

┌─────────────────────────────────────────────────────────────────┐
│ Nueva Sesión                                                    │
├─────────────────────────────────────────────────────────────────┤
│                                                                 │
│  Nombre de la sesión                                           │
│  ┌─────────────────────────────────────────────────────────┐   │
│  │ Revisión de documentación                               │   │
│  └─────────────────────────────────────────────────────────┘   │
│                                                                 │
│  Agente                                                         │
│  ┌─────────────────────────────────────────────────────────┐   │
│  │ documentation-engineer                              ▼   │   │
│  └─────────────────────────────────────────────────────────┘   │
│                                                                 │
│  Proyecto (opcional)                                           │
│  ┌─────────────────────────────────────────────────────────┐   │
│  │ Platform                                            ▼   │   │
│  └─────────────────────────────────────────────────────────┘   │
│                                                                 │
│  [Cancelar]                               [Crear sesión]       │
│                                                                 │
└─────────────────────────────────────────────────────────────────┘

Paso 2: Completar campos

Campo Descripción
Nombre Título descriptivo para identificar la sesión
Agente Selecciona el agente especializado
Proyecto Asociar a un proyecto (opcional)

Paso 3: Crear

Haz clic en Crear sesión. La sesión se activa automáticamente.

Cambiar de sesión

Para cambiar a otra sesión:

  1. Haz clic en la sesión deseada en el panel izquierdo
  2. La conversación se carga en el panel central
  3. El contexto se actualiza

Múltiples sesiones

Puedes tener varias sesiones abiertas y cambiar entre ellas sin perder el contexto.

Renombrar sesión

  1. Haz clic derecho en la sesión
  2. Selecciona Renombrar
  3. Escribe el nuevo nombre
  4. Presiona Enter

Eliminar sesión

  1. Haz clic derecho en la sesión
  2. Selecciona Eliminar
  3. Confirma la eliminación

Irreversible

Eliminar una sesión borra todo el historial de conversación.

Estados de sesión

Estado Icono Descripción
Activa Sesión seleccionada actualmente
Con actividad 🔵 Tiene mensajes no leídos
Inactiva - Sin actividad reciente
Archivada 📦 Guardada pero no visible

Filtrar sesiones

Por texto

Escribe en el campo de búsqueda para filtrar por nombre.

Por agente

  1. Haz clic en el filtro de agente
  2. Selecciona un agente específico
  3. Solo se muestran sesiones con ese agente

Por proyecto

  1. Haz clic en el filtro de proyecto
  2. Selecciona un proyecto
  3. Solo se muestran sesiones asociadas

Archivar sesiones

Para mantener el panel limpio:

  1. Haz clic derecho en la sesión
  2. Selecciona Archivar
  3. La sesión se oculta pero no se elimina

Ver sesiones archivadas

  1. Haz clic en Mostrar archivadas
  2. Aparecen las sesiones archivadas
  3. Puedes restaurarlas con clic derecho > Restaurar

Historial de sesión

Cada sesión mantiene historial completo:

  • Todos los mensajes enviados y recibidos
  • Acciones ejecutadas
  • Cambios de contexto
  • Timestamps

Exportar historial

  1. Haz clic derecho en la sesión
  2. Selecciona Exportar
  3. Elige formato (Markdown, JSON)
  4. Se descarga el archivo

Sesiones recientes

La lista muestra las sesiones más recientes primero.

Sesiones con más de 30 días de inactividad se archivan automáticamente (configurable).

Límite de sesiones

Límite

Puedes tener hasta 50 sesiones activas. Archiva o elimina las que no uses.

Atajos de teclado

Atajo Acción
Ctrl+N Nueva sesión
Alt+1 a Alt+9 Cambiar a sesión 1-9
Ctrl+W Cerrar sesión actual

Siguiente: Conversaciones - Cómo interactuar con los agentes.